EPL DFS Lineup Picks for DraftKings (11/5/22) - English Premier League Soccer Matchweek 15

Brandon's DraftKings EPL DFS lineup picks for English Premier League soccer on 11/5/22 (Matchweek 15). His top daily fantasy soccer forwards, midfielders, defenders, goalkeepers.

Welcome back to “The Kick-Off”! We are here for Gameweek 15 after the conclusion of the Group Stage in the Champions League and Europa League!!! Today’s slate will feature overwhelming favorites, Manchester City -750. This slate will center around Manchester City and you will need to get creative elsewhere in order to ship your desired GPP. I will guide you through this four-match slate starting at 11:00 A.M. EST. Please Be Advised: Due to the quick turnaround of gameweeks, there can be an increased risk of rest for players. This write-up does not cover the late game on FanDuel because of the differences in the DraftKings and FanDuel slates.

The Kick-Off - EPL Matchweek 15

Vegas Odds for the Day

Goalies

Ederson- DK $5.9K || FD $13

Opponent - Fulham

Ever since Ederson conceded three goals to rivals Manchester United, the keeper has conceded 2 goals over the span of 4 matches. He also has made 7 saves during that run with 5 of them being against Leicester City. With a four-match slate and Manchester City being the heavy favorites, Ederson will see the majority of ownership at the position. The only downfall of Ederson, is the lack of floor he provides due to the lack of shots he sees.

Forwards

Erling Haaland-DK $11.9K || FD $24

Opponent - Fulham

When Manchester City is on the slate, we all know Haaland will be talked about somewhere. The youngster in 13 appearances in all competitions this season has 20 goals, 2 assists, 55 shots, 14 created chances and 3 crosses. Haaland continues to take the reigns in scoring for the Premier League and he will have yet another worthwhile matchup against Fulham this weekend. Fulham currently sits in the bottom of the league in goals against per 90 – 0.15 – and shots conceded per 90 – 1.23 –.    

Rodrigo- DK $8.3K || FD $19

Opponent - AFC Bournemouth

As is tradition, we must highlight a player facing Bournemouth. Realistically, there are not many solidified strikers outside of Erling Haaland on the slate and Rodrigo is the next best option. Despite teammate Patrick Bamford being healthy, Rodrigo is still starting up top for Leeds United. Through 11 appearances this season in all competitions, the striker has 6 goals, 1 assist, 33 shots, 10 created chances and 10 corners. Bournemouth is the second-worst in the league in conceded goals against per 90 – 0.18 – and they are the third-worst in shots against per 90 – 1.45 –.

Midfielders

Kevin De Bruyne- DK $9.9K || FD $21

Opponent - Fulham

The idea that we are getting De Bruyne at this salary alone is crazy when considering his form. Add to the fact that he could play as a False 9 if teammate Erling Haaland doesn’t start, making it even better. The midfielder is in superb form right now amassing 2 goals, 1 assist, 12 shots, 14 created chances, 32 crosses and 9 corners in his last five appearances in all competitions. Surprisingly, Fulham does not concede many created chances per game, but they do concede the second-most shots assisted per game. It will be imperative to have the majority set-pieces taker for the overwhelming favorite on the slate in ‘cash’ lineups.      

Brenden Aaronson- DK $6.3K || FD $14

Opponent - AFC Bournemouth

Aaronson could see a ‘good’ amount of ownership on the slate in ‘cash’ lineups thanks to his uptick in corners as of late. The midfielder is back and healthy and he has taken more set-pieces than teammate Jack Harrison whose salary is much more than Aaronson’s. Unfortunately for the midfielder, he has yet to get a point in over a month though, last assisting a goal in a 1-1 draw against Everton. Over his 12 appearances this season, he has 1 goal, 1 assist, 15 shots, 24 created chances, 34 crosses, 20 corners and 22 tackles in all competitions.

Defense

Neco Williams- DK $5.5K || FD $11

Opponent - Brentford

After trailing in form the past few matches, Neco was given a rest, coming off the bench in the 5-0 defeat by Arsenal. The fullback did wonders, sending 5 crosses, taking 3 corners and making 1 interception. He will get a much-friendlier matchup at home against Brentford this weekend. The visitors do not concede an abundance of crosses per game, but Neco should get enough space to maneuver the flank as he pleases. In 13 appearances – 11 starts – this season, he has 18 shots, 10 created chances, 52 crosses, 11 corners, 38 tackles, 24 interceptions and 16 clearances in all competitions. Those are solid peripheral numbers and something he needs to start providing again given the lack of offensive support Nottingham Forest possesses.          

Issa Diop- DK $2.5K || FD $9

Opponent - Manchester City

Looking more at the FanDuel platform, albeit having value on DraftKings, Diop will be plenty busy in a meeting with Manchester City this weekend. The defender will be parked in front of his keeper the entire game attempting to stop Erling Haaland and company from scoring. This will provide many opportunities to rack up defensive peripherals which is more favorable on FanDuel’s platform but can be done on DraftKings as well. Through 6 appearances – 4 starts –, Diop has 1 goal, 1 shot, 3 tackles, 2 interceptions and 10 clearances.
